ATU 934
Tales of the Predestined Death (previously The Prince and the Storm)

Motifs the recorded variants carry
- Three fates, "norns", prophesy at child's birth. 12 variants
- Prophecy: death on wedding day. 12 variants
- Prophecy: death by storm. 12 variants
- Prophecy: death by drowning. 12 variants
- Prophecy: death by wolf. Killed by a wolf claw (or by a cat transformed to wolf). 12 variants
- Prophecy: death from snakebite. 12 variants
- Vain attempts to escape fulfillment of prophecy. (Cf. M341.2.10, M343, M344.) 12 variants
- Confinement in tower to avoid fulfillment of prophecy. 12 variants
- Prophecy: death at (before, within) certain time. 6 variants
- Prophecy: death at certain age. 6 variants
- Prophecy: death by particular instrument. In spite of all precautions the prophecy is fulfilled. 6 variants
- Prophecy of death fulfilled. 6 variants
- Extraordinary threefold death: falling from rock and tree, drowning. 4 variants
- Extraordinary threefold death: wounding, burning, drowning. 4 variants
- Prophecy: three-fold death. Child to die from hunger, fire, and water. It so happens. 4 variants
